Jung von Matt Limmat: Is that from Livique?
In the first campaign for Livique, Jung von Matt Limmat emphasizes the individuality of living with a specially composed song and visually powerful scenes. At the center is the key question "Is this from Livique?", which is intended to playfully strengthen the brand presence of the Swiss furniture store.
The newly launched campaign for the furniture store Livique aims to celebrate individuality within your own four walls. With a wink, a pinch of coolness and a dash of charm, Jung von Matt Limmat shows how Livique can bring furniture with character into Swiss households.
In childhood, it is often other people's toys that fascinate us and prompt us to ask: "Where did you get that?" In adulthood, toys are often replaced by things like fashion, jewelry or furniture. The latter turn your own four walls into a mirror of your own personality and often lead visitors to ask: "Where did you get that?". This is precisely where Jung von Matt Limmat's campaign for Livique comes in, making the question "Is this from Livique?" the focal point of communication.

The heart of the campaign is a song that musically focuses on the pressing question "Is this from Livique?". The song was created in collaboration with Tommy Peters and was conceived and written especially for Livique.
The music spot for the campaign shows scenes that reflect life in different phases of life. The dynamic camera work pans through various backdrops and is accompanied by the soundtrack with the question "Is that from Livique?". In this way, Jung von Matt Limmat and Livique want to appeal to all the senses in Switzerland.
The entire campaign has been running throughout Switzerland on TV, print, OOH, digital and in-store since Monday.
